Glass cloth tape is a specialized adhesive tape that is composed of woven glass cloth backing and a pressure-sensitive adhesive. This type of tape is known for its high heat resistance, good insulation properties, and exceptional tensile strength, making it a popular choice in various industries. The glass cloth backing provides durability and flexibility, allowing the tape to conform to irregular surfaces and withstand harsh environmental conditions.
Due to its unique composition, glass cloth tape is commonly used for applications that require high temperature resistance, electrical insulation, and strong adhesion. Industries such as aerospace, automotive, electronics, and construction utilize glass cloth tape for applications such as insulation of electrical components, heat shielding, bundling of wires and cables, and reinforcing of seams and joints. Its versatility and reliability make it a valuable asset in demanding working environments where traditional tapes may not meet the required specifications.

Glass cloth tape finds extensive applications in the aerospace market for its high-temperature resistance and ability to provide electrical insulation in aircraft components. Moreover, its lightweight properties make it a desirable material for use in aircraft interior applications such as wire harnessing, cable wrapping, and composite bonding. The durability and strength of glass cloth tape make it an ideal choice for ensuring the reliability and safety of critical aerospace systems.
In the automotive sector, glass cloth tape is widely utilized for harnessing and insulating electrical wires, especially in high-performance vehicles where temperature and vibration resistance are crucial. With its excellent dielectric strength and chemical resistance, glass cloth tape plays a vital role in protecting wiring systems from environmental factors and electrical failures. Additionally, its conformability allows for easy application in complex shapes and tight spaces, making it an indispensable tool for automotive manufacturers seeking reliable and long-lasting wire protection solutions.

The glass cloth tape market is a competitive landscape dominated by several key players who have established a strong presence in the market. Companies such as 3M, Nitto Denko Corporation, Saint-Gobain, and Tesa SE are leading the way with their extensive product lines and innovative solutions in glass cloth tape manufacturing. These key players have built a reputation for reliability, quality, and durability, making them go-to choices for customers across various industries.
In addition to the market leaders, there are also emerging players in the glass cloth tape market that are making a significant impact with their focus on niche markets and specialized products. Companies like Intertape Polymer Group and PPI Adhesive Products are gaining traction by offering tailored solutions to meet specific customer needs.
